LM2576D2T-015 Equivalent & Substitute Parts

Part Overview

The LM2576D2T-015 is a buck switching regulator IC from onsemi, designed for step-down voltage conversion with a fixed 15V output and 3A current capacity. This component operates across a 7V to 40V input range with a 52kHz switching frequency and is housed in a TO-263-6 D2PAK package. The part is currently classified as obsolete, making identification of functionally equivalent alternatives essential for ongoing design support and production continuity.

Key Parameters

Parameter Value
Manufacturer Part Number LM2576D2T-015
Manufacturer onsemi
Category Power Management (PMIC)
Function Step-Down (Buck)
Output Voltage (Fixed) 15V
Output Current 3A
Input Voltage Range 7V to 40V
Switching Frequency 52kHz
Package Type TO-263-6, D2PAK (5 Leads + Tab)
Operating Temperature -40°C to 125°C (TJ)
Product Status Obsolete
RoHS Status RoHS Non-Compliant

Substitute Part Grouping Explanation

Substitution eligibility for the LM2576D2T-015 is determined by the following critical parameters:

Direct Substitutes must match:

  • Fixed output voltage: 15V
  • Package type: TO-263-6, D2PAK (5 Leads + Tab)
  • Mounting type: Surface Mount
  • Switching frequency: 52kHz
  • Operating temperature range: -40°C to 125°C
  • Output configuration: Positive or Negative

Similar Substitutes may vary in:

  • Output current capacity (lower acceptable if design permits)
  • Input voltage range (higher maximum acceptable)
  • Output configuration (Positive acceptable for Positive or Negative designs)
  • Product status (Active preferred over Obsolete)
  • RoHS compliance (ROHS3 Compliant preferred)

Parameter Comparison

Parameter LM2576D2T-015 LM2576D2T-15G TL2575-15IKTTR TL2575HV-15IKTTR
Manufacturer onsemi onsemi Texas Instruments Texas Instruments
Output Voltage (Fixed) 15V 15V 15V 15V
Output Current 3A 3A 1A 1A
Input Voltage Range 7V to 40V 7V to 40V 4.75V to 40V 4.75V to 60V
Switching Frequency 52kHz 52kHz 52kHz 52kHz
Package Type TO-263-6, D2PAK TO-263-6, D2PAK TO-263-6, D2PAK TO-263-6, D2PAK
Operating Temperature -40°C to 125°C -40°C to 125°C -40°C to 125°C -40°C to 125°C
Output Configuration Positive or Negative Positive or Negative Positive Positive
Product Status Obsolete Active Active Active
RoHS Status RoHS Non-Compliant ROHS3 Compliant ROHS3 Compliant ROHS3 Compliant
Packaging - Tube Tape & Reel (TR) Tape & Reel (TR)

Engineering Selection Recommendations

LM2576D2T-15G (Direct Substitute)

This onsemi part is the primary equivalent for the LM2576D2T-015. It maintains identical electrical specifications, output current capacity (3A), input voltage range (7V to 40V), and package configuration. The LM2576D2T-15G is currently in active production status with ROHS3 compliance, addressing the obsolescence and regulatory limitations of the original part. TL2575-15IKTTR and TL2575HV-15IKTTR (Similar Substitutes)

These Texas Instruments alternatives provide functional equivalence with design trade-offs. Both parts maintain the 15V fixed output, 52kHz switching frequency, and identical package type. The primary limitation is reduced output current capacity (1A versus 3A), restricting use to applications requiring lower current delivery. The TL2575HV-15IKTTR extends the maximum input voltage to 60V, providing enhanced input range flexibility compared to the original 40V specification. Both parts are ROHS3 compliant and actively produced. Selection of these alternatives requires verification that application current requirements do not exceed 1A.

Frequently Asked Questions (FAQ)

Q: Can the LM2576D2T-15G directly replace the LM2576D2T-015 without circuit modification?

A: Yes. The LM2576D2T-15G is a direct substitute with identical electrical and mechanical specifications. No circuit redesign is required. The primary differences are product status (Active versus Obsolete) and RoHS compliance (ROHS3 versus Non-Compliant).

Q: What are the limitations when using TL2575-15IKTTR or TL2575HV-15IKTTR as substitutes?

A: The output current capacity is reduced from 3A to 1A. These parts are suitable only for applications with maximum current draw of 1A or less. If your design requires the full 3A output capacity, these alternatives are not appropriate. Both parts are manufactured by Texas Instruments and maintain the same 15V output voltage and 52kHz switching frequency.

Q: Are the Texas Instruments alternatives pin-compatible with the original part?

A: Yes. All substitute parts use the TO-263-6 D2PAK package with identical pinout and lead configuration. Physical board layout compatibility is maintained.

Q: Does the TL2575HV-15IKTTR offer any advantage over the TL2575-15IKTTR?

A: The TL2575HV-15IKTTR supports a maximum input voltage of 60V compared to 40V for the TL2575-15IKTTR. If your application requires input voltages above 40V, the HV variant is necessary. Both parts share identical output current (1A) and output voltage (15V) specifications.

Q: What is the moisture sensitivity level difference between the original part and substitutes?

A: The LM2576D2T-015 has MSL 1 (Unlimited). The LM2576D2T-15G maintains MSL 1. The Texas Instruments alternatives (TL2575-15IKTTR and TL2575HV-15IKTTR) have MSL 3 (168 Hours), requiring controlled storage and handling conditions during manufacturing.

Q: Is RoHS compliance a critical factor for part selection?

A: RoHS compliance depends on your application and regulatory requirements. The LM2576D2T-015 is RoHS Non-Compliant. The LM2576D2T-15G and both Texas Instruments alternatives are ROHS3 Compliant. If your end product requires RoHS certification, select from the compliant alternatives.
